Abstract
Integrated Manufacturing Systems Troubleshooting (IMST) Level II, also referred to as the Mechatronics Capstone, is a competency-based course that presents students with a series of lectures, exercises and troubleshooting labs. The function of the Capstone is for students to demonstrate proficiency in their IMST skills, using the training gained in areas such as Print Reading, PLC to Robot Interfacing, Troubleshooting, Remote I/O, and Sequence Diagrams. The IMST Level II materials were developed by specialized subject matter experts, Glenn Wisniewski and Weston Bye.
